Francois Boucher's "Vertumnus And Pomona": Critique

Abstract: 4 pages in length. The 1757 oil on canvas Vertumnus and Pomona is considered one of French artist Francois Boucher's most appreciated pieces. At the time this particular painting was created, the social, political and economical impact of the arts was experiencing a rebirth of sorts that helped to establish Europe as an artisan's heaven. Most impressed by his eye for detail and whimsical approach was the royal sect, who so proudly displayed his artistic endeavors and even commissioned him to create personal pieces.
